Overview of Steel Penstock Gates

Steel penstock gates are mechanical devices designed to control water flow in channels, reservoirs, and pipelines. They act as barriers that can completely stop or regulate water, ensuring efficient water management. Unlike traditional cast iron gates, steel penstock gates are lightweight yet strong, providing long-term performance and resistance to corrosion.

Design and Material Specifications

Steel penstock gates are typically manufactured using high-grade stainless steel, which prevents rusting and maintains structural integrity under high pressure and prolonged exposure to water. The standard components include:

  • Gate frame
  • Gate plate
  • Sealing strips
  • Valve stem
  • Brackets and supports
  • Manual or electric actuator mechanisms

Applications and Industry Uses

Steel penstock gates are widely used in sectors that require precise water flow control. Key applications include:

  • Water treatment plants: For controlling inflow and outflow in treatment processes.
  • Sewage and wastewater systems: To manage water levels and prevent backflow.
  • Hydroelectric power stations: Regulating water for turbines.
  • Irrigation systems: Controlling water distribution in agricultural fields.
  • Industrial plants: Chemical, petroleum, and metallurgical industries for liquid control.
  • Flood control and dams: Emergency closure and flow management.

Installation and Maintenance Tips

Proper installation and maintenance are critical to maximize the lifespan of steel penstock gates. Follow these recommendations:

  • Ensure the mounting surface is level and free from debris before installation.
  • Lubricate the valve stem and actuator mechanism regularly to prevent wear.
  • Inspect sealing strips periodically for signs of wear or damage.
  • Perform corrosion checks, particularly in wastewater or chemical applications.
  • Test the gate operation under partial flow before full commissioning.
  • Clean and flush channels to prevent sediment buildup that may affect sealing.
